Introduction to Laser Marking Techniques

Laser marking is a process that involves using high-powered lasers to alter the surface of a material. This process can be applied in various ways, including engraving, annealing, foaming, staining, and removing techniques. Each of these methods serves a distinct purpose and is suitable for different applications, ranging from industrial to artistic uses.

The choice of technique and the specific laser machine to use depends largely on the application. Laser marking is widely used in industries such as electronics, automotive, aerospace, medical devices, and packaging. It is also a popular choice in small-scale craft work and customizations.

Factors Influencing Laser Marker Selection

The decision to choose a specific laser marking technique or machine can be influenced by several factors, including the type of material to be marked, the required precision, the budget, and personal preferences.

Material Suitability

The material being marked plays a crucial role in determining the most suitable laser marking method. For instance, metal surfaces can be easily marked using CO2 or fiber lasers, while plastics, ceramics, and glass require different techniques. Additionally, the chosen method should be capable of providing the desired level of precision and permanence.

Application Specificity

The intended application of the marked product is another key factor. For instance, if you are in the small business or handcrafted industry, it would be beneficial to select a laser marker that can offer precise and detailed engraving on non-metal materials. CO2 laser engravers are particularly popular in this sector due to their versatility and ease of use.

CO2 Laser Engravers: A Preferred Choice

CO2 laser engravers are favored by many for their user-friendly design and versatility. These machines are suitable for marking a wide range of materials, including wood, acrylic, cardboard, leather, and non-metallic composites. Hand-craft enthusiasts and small business managers often appreciate the precision and efficiency that CO2 laser engravers provide. They can create detailed and intricate designs that add value to products, making them ideal for personalized gifts, custom signage, and artistic creations.

Benefits of CO2 Laser Engravers

Ease of Use: CO2 laser engravers are designed to be user-friendly, even for those with limited technical knowledge. They offer intuitive software interfaces that simplify the marking process. Versatility: These machines can be used for both engraving and cutting various materials, making them a versatile tool for different projects. Precision: CO2 lasers can produce high-resolution engravings with fine details, ensuring that the final product meets professional standards.
